EVBox reaches milestone with 50,000 EV charging points installed worldwide

EVBox, global leading manufacturer of electric vehicle charging stations and charging management software, reaches milestone of 50,000 installed charging points worldwide. Number 50,000 was installed at the Los Angeles Cleantech Incubator (LACI) in LA, California.

With an organizational focus on tackling the challenges in pushing regional electrification in transportation, adding EVBox’s 50,000th charger to the Electric Vehicle Showcase at the La Kretz Innovation Campus fits well with LACI’s goals.

LACI Chief Partnerships Officer, Ben Stapleton explains: “We believe LA should be a global focal point for advancing electric vehicle infrastructure and mobility innovation. That’s why we’re building a state of the art EV Showcase at the La Kretz Innovation Campus where we can demonstrate a variety of smart charging equipment, EV’s, and mobility solutions. We’re pleased to have a global leader such as EVBox as a partner on this project.”

Record setting EV adoption in US
In 2016, electric cars surpassed the 2 million mark worldwide, with an impressive 43% growth in EV sales in the US alone. With battery prices dropping, and with new long-range electric vehicle models being released monthly, EV’s are becoming widely available to all.

“With this rising demand for electric cars, comes also the shared responsibility to provide a good electric infrastructure. From our Manifesto of Electric Mobility1 we know that 55% of electric drivers in the US ask for a wider availability of charging points. Together with passionate partners such as LACI we can give electric drivers the driving experience they expect and deserve. Hitting the 50,000 mark is a direct result of that ambition of which we are all extremely proud.” says Kristof Vereenooghe, CEO of EVBox.

Getting to number 50,000

With the 50,000th installation, EVBox now supports electric drivers’ needs in 30 different countries worldwide. Vereenooghe continues: ‘We see this alarming trend of record heatwaves and melting glaciers. Meanwhile we are experiencing an ever-increasing consumer demand for electric vehicles and our charging stations. Large scale adoption of electric vehicles is going to happen and it’s our mission to drive sustainable mobility by bringing leading electric vehicle solutions to the world.’ EVBox is actively expanding its US and global based workforce to support the record setting adoption of electric vehicles.

Vereenooghe adds: “We achieved 50,000 charging points in under seven years and we plan on achieving the next 50,000 in under two years.”
